EDITORS COMMENTS
This print captures the essence of Sita's marriage procession in a chariot, beautifully depicted in a granite carving at the Prasanna Chennakeshava Temple. Created by the Indian School in the 13th century, this intricate relief showcases the rich cultural heritage and artistic prowess of ancient India. The image transports us to Somnathpur, Karnataka, where this architectural marvel stands as a testament to Hoysala kings' patronage and devotion. Sri Channakeshara, intricately carved on the temple walls, presides over this grand spectacle as he blesses Sita on her auspicious wedding day. Sita's union with Rama, the seventh incarnation of Vishnu in Hinduism, is an iconic tale from the epic Ramayana. This narrative unfolds through meticulously crafted friezes that adorn every corner of this sacred space. The attention to detail is evident as we observe yalis guarding these carvings with their fierce yet majestic presence. As we delve deeper into this visual masterpiece, we are captivated by Sita herself – radiant and adorned in all her bridal glory. Her marriage procession comes alive before our eyes; musicians playing melodious tunes fill the air while devotees gather to witness this divine union.
